C# String操作(字符重复出现,截取字符,连接字符)

using System;

class UsingSConstructor
{
    static void Main(string[] args)
    {
        string Str= "ABCDE";
        char[] theCharArray= Str.ToCharArray(); //将Ex字符串转化为字符数组
        String newString1 = new String(theCharArray);//接受字符数组作为字符串对象的内容
        Console.WriteLine("字符数组{A,B,C,D,E}:" + newString1);

        String newString2 = new String(theCharArray[0], 5);//同样个字符,出现n次
        Console.WriteLine("字符A连续输出5次:" + newString2);

        String newString3 = new String(theCharArray, 2, 4);//截取某个字符数组,从第索引2开始的取4个字符结束
        Console.WriteLine
            ("字符数组{A,B,C,D,E}索引位置2开始的3个字符:" + newString3);

        Console.ReadLine();
    }
}

你可能感兴趣的:(C# String操作(字符重复出现,截取字符,连接字符))